Old Town Touring Canoes
More speed, enhanced tracking, greater secondary stability, the ability
to deal with a variety of paddling conditions, including whitewater,
and a large payload make these canoes well-suited to multi-day trips.
Appalachian
Created especially
for whitewater tripping, this canoe offers moderate
rocker for excellent maneuverability, flared ends
for dryness and buoyancy, and a shallow arch for smooth
transition from initial to secondary stability when
leaning the boat.

Penobscot Series
A nimble, light-footed,
amazingly durable boat for the intermediate to experienced
paddler. Sharp entry and straight keel line for speed
and efficiency. A consistent top performer in the
downriver whitewater nationals, it's equally at home
in fast moving or still water.
